Nice to see you again Aces,

I had the pleasure of meeting Simon many years ago in The Rainbow. I was a brag player back then and could hardly play poker to save my life!

I believe that a lot of the influx of new poker players comes from not just the internet game, but from the Late Night Poker tv series of a few years ago. So, to my way of thinking, it is more the characters like Simon, DC, Barny and Ross, Joe Beevers, Ram, Dave D-Fish etc. who have filled the cardrooms of the world with a more cerebral type of player, rather than faceless internet geeks who throw everything at nothing and hope for the best. Poker roullette, I think Mr Jackson calls it.

Simon is a fearsome competitor and it is to his (and Pauls) great credit that they take a £30 tourney so seriously. If Aces stared down my chip stack once, he must have done it 50 times! I was bold enough to ask him of his intentions and he was sporting enough to tell me of his modus operandi. "I am just establishing whether I will get an automatic call from you", he said.

Playing poker means knowing exactly where your opponents are as well as yourself.

Thanks again for the game and well played.
